The Minister of National Security, Patricia Bullrichconfirmed this Monday that he will meet tomorrow with the Paraguayan Police to deepen the investigation of the hypothesis that Loan Danilo Peñathe 5-year-old boy who disappeared 11 days ago, has been taken to that country.

“Tomorrow I am going to talk to the Paraguayan police. As it is a hypothesis, we want the Paraguayan police work at a really hard pace because it is a hypothesis that, having accessed the cause yesterday, we have it as a possible hypothesis. So tomorrow I am going to be with the Paraguayan police watching this case,” the official said in an interview with Radio Miter.

According to reports from Security, the minister had planned a trip to Paraguay for some time to attend a summit of the Organization of American States to be held this week in Asunción, and will take advantage of her stay in that city to meet with representatives of the local police. .

Bullrich once again insisted that the ministry in his charge collaborates from the first moment with the investigation of the boy who disappeared on June 13 in the rural area of ​​9 de Julio, in Corrientes.

“From the first second that we learned of Loan’s disappearance, the people search system of the Ministry of Security moved to Corrientes, was on the scene, set up an entire search conducted by the Corrientes police and the Minister of Security of Corrientes. , in hypotheses that we did not know about, because we had access to the case only yesterday,” said the minister.

“We do not want to handle hypotheses, because we precisely believe that this is an issue that has generated a lot of confusion. There are many hypotheses, and The worst thing for a criminal investigation is to have five hypotheses, six hypotheses“added the head of the Security portfolio.

The minister stressed that the teams in her portfolio collaborate on all relevant tasks based on what they receive from local investigative forces. “We, who We just agreed to the case yesterdaytoday we are following what the provincial justice tells us,” he explained.

“If they give us access to the analysis of the cause, we can work on a hypothesis. If we do not have access to the cause, it is very difficult to work on a hypothesis without knowing what is inside,” he added.

Loan’s disappearance

Loan Danilo Peña disappeared on June 13 after participating in a lunch at his grandmother’s house, located in a rural area of ​​9 de Julio, in the western region of the province of Corrientes.

After an intense search for several days in the area, local Justice has now focused the investigation of the boy’s whereabouts on the hypothesis of a kidnapping for the purpose of human trafficking.

An uncle of Loan and a couple of his friends were the first arrested in the case, who were joined this weekend by a municipal official and her husband – a former ship captain – who participated in the lunch and hours later traveled to the province of Chaco in a Ford Ka car in which trained dogs found olfactory traces of the child.

The commissioner who was in charge of the search operation at the beginning is also in prison, accused of possible cover-up.
